Founded in 2006 as a resource for developing country missions, the Washington Embassy Network (WEN) facilitates information sharing and dialogue on strategies to promote innovation-led growth. The WEN provides an informal, collegial environment for discussion of priority issues for economic and social development relating to trade, technology transfer, intellectual property (IP) and the environment.
How WEN Works
The Washington Embassy Network (WEN) provides a different kind of forum. Washington area diplomatic missions host the WEN on a rotating basis and set the agenda for each WEN Luncheon, enabling openness and candor in discussion of issues relating to knowledge-intensive economic development for creation of economic and social value. In many cases, participants find that the answers are literally in the room.
The WEN uses Chatham House Rules -- no media is allowed in the room and nothing that is said can be quoted afterwards without express permission. This contributes to a freshness of the discussion and has led to memorable, ground-breaking sessions.
